smithley Posted July 10, 2012 #1 Share Posted July 10, 2012 Just back from Serenade of the Seas Med cruise. If you're interested in going to the beach in Cannes, here's info on the municipal beach. From the tender dock, walk to the main street and take a right. You'll wind around a marina and past a lovely park. You'll pass a large hotel (Majestic Barriera?) with its beach area. Keep walking along the boulevard de la Croisette. Look for Plage Mace - blue and yellow umbrellas. Or, if you want to walk to the end of la Croisette, look for Plage Zamenhoff. The beach areas are open 8:30 - 6:30. You can rent chairs and umbrellas for 1/2 day (8:30 - 1:30 or 1:30 - 6:30 or full day. Cost for 2 people (2 deck chairs, 1 umbrella, 1 table - restrooms and showers available - lockers extra) was 11.10 euro for the 1/2 day and 20.10 euro for the full day. In August, it may be more difficult to find a place since evidently many French hit Cannes for their vacations.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Rare Hlitner Posted July 10, 2012 #2 Share Posted July 10, 2012 We have often posted about the Plage du Midi which is located about a 5 min walk from the tender pier. If you had simply walked towards the left (keeping the water on your left) you would have found a fine free sandy beach only a few minutes stroll from the pier.
